Stålhaugen
Stålhaugen is a hill in Øygarden, Western Norway. Stålhaugen is situated nearby to the hamlet Sæle, as well as near Hummelsund.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Bakkasund is a village in Austevoll Municipality in Vestland county, Norway. The village is located on the southeastern side of the island of Storakalsøy.

Austevoll is a municipality in Hordaland in Norway. It consists of an arcipelago of islands bordering the North Sea to its west, and is lightly populated with the largest settlement being Storebø with approximately 1000 inhabitants.
